The Property

Sitting in the charming and favoured village of Repton, Derbyshire, this individually designed detached residence offers a perfect blend of modern living and comfort. With three bedrooms, this home provides flexible accommodation that can easily adapt to your needs. The ground floor features a spacious lounge, ideal for relaxation, a dressing room or study, a bedroom or home-office, and a delightful dining kitchen, which boasts attractively fitted units complemented by granite worktops, making it a perfect space for entertaining family and friends.

The property is equipped with underfloor heating on the ground floor, ensuring a warm and inviting atmosphere throughout the colder months. Additionally, the first floor bedrooms benefit from air conditioning, providing a cool retreat during the summer. The modern bathroom on the ground floor and the ensuite bathroom on the first floor add to the convenience and luxury of this home.

Outside, you will find ample parking for several vehicles. The low-maintenance courtyard garden, has attractive bay trees and an artificial lawn, offering a serene outdoor space for relaxation or social gatherings without the hassle of extensive upkeep.

LOCATION
Repton is a popular village full of charm and character along its high street. Famous for its school, the village offers a butcher's, a post office and a convenience store, a thriving village hall with cafe, dentist, hairdressers, beauticians, and a stunning church. In the nearby village of Willington are doctors, pharmacy, co-op and a train station. There is excellent travel via the A38 and A50 to Derby, Nottingham, Stoke on Trent, Birmingham and East Midlands Airport.
